Mt. Gox, the defunct Japanese cryptocurrency exchange, has transferred a total of 11,501 bitcoins, valued at approximately $1.01 billion, to two different wallets. According to on-chain data from Arkham Intelligence, 893 bitcoins, worth about $78.11 million, were moved to Mt. Gox's hot wallet, while 10,608 bitcoins, valued at around $927.48 million, were transferred to a change wallet. This recent movement of funds marks the third significant on-chain transfer by Mt. Gox in the past four weeks, following transfers of over $900 million on March 11 and over $1 billion on March 6.
